Walter G. Minnick 1923 - 2005

Walter G Minnick of Dallas, Dallas County, TX was born on July 9, 1923. Walter Minnick was married to Jeanne M. (Hill) Minnick on July 29, 1978 in Dallas County, TX, and died at age 82 years old on September 16, 2005.
